While hundreds of Russians have fled or are fleeing, it isn’t a straightforward factor to perform.
Russians looking for to keep away from being drafted to struggle are flying to solely 4 international locations that also have direct aircraft connections—Serbia, Turkey, Georgia and Armenia. The value of a technique has soared. Still, 50,000 Russians have fled to Serbia for the reason that battle started.
Another 40,000 fled to neighboring Georgia, the place no visa is required. The day after Putin made his battle announcement, there was a six-mile again up of automobiles on the Georgia border made up of Russians looking for to get out.
Meanwhile, to the north, the three Baltic states – Estonia, Latvia and Lithuania – closed their borders, as did Finland, saying they won’t grant asylum to Russians fleeing mobilization.
And to the southeast extra Russians are crossing into Mongolia.
